summaryrefslogtreecommitdiff
path: root/driver/tcpm/tcpci.c
Commit message (Expand)AuthorAgeFilesLines
* coil: remove usbc, usb_pd, charge_manager, and tcpmMary Ruthven2021-01-061-1014/+0
* trembyle: tcpc fault needs to be clearedDenis Brockus2019-11-251-0/+22
* Add a board specific helper to return USB PD port countKarthikeyan Ramasubramanian2019-11-091-1/+4
* Rename CONFIG_USB_PD_PORT_COUNT as CONFIG_USB_PD_PORT_MAX_COUNTKarthikeyan Ramasubramanian2019-11-011-7/+7
* tcpci: fix tcpc_alert error messageCaveh Jalali2019-11-011-2/+2
* tcpci: remove extra write when sending HARD_RSTJett Rink2019-10-231-0/+10
* tcpci: protect against buffer overflowCaveh Jalali2019-10-111-6/+12
* trembyle: board specific fast switch enable/disableDenis Brockus2019-10-091-0/+2
* tcpc: driver changes for FRSDenis Brockus2019-10-071-1/+44
* tcpci: add missing CPRINTS argumentCaveh Jalali2019-09-261-1/+1
* usb_pd: Adding USB-C cable detectionAyushee2019-08-161-1/+10
* ps8xxx: disable DCI modeCaveh Jalali2019-08-141-6/+4
* usb: convert cc1 from int to enumJett Rink2019-08-091-1/+2
* Remove __7b, __8b and __7bfDenis Brockus2019-07-201-14/+14
* ec_commands: Rename 'renew' to 'live' in EC_CMD_USB_PD_CHIP_INFOKarthikeyan Ramasubramanian2019-07-201-3/+3
* Use 7bit I2C/SPI slave addresses in ECDenis Brockus2019-07-191-15/+21
* TCPC: Make tcpc_config handle other bus typesDaisuke Nojiri2019-06-101-14/+14
* usbpd: Fix infinite init loopDaisuke Nojiri2019-06-071-5/+5
* driver/tcpm: Tidy tcpci_tcpm_transmitJacob Garber2019-05-281-10/+8
* tcpci/usb_pd_fuzz: Avoid using unitialized data in payloadNicolas Boichat2019-05-161-0/+2
* TCPC: Set charger vbus during initDiana Z2019-04-151-0/+7
* common: replace 1 << digits, with BIT(digits)Gwendal Grignou2019-03-261-1/+1
* Ampton: Set the PS8751 to source mode before enter low power modeJames_Chao2019-01-251-1/+1
* pd: Enable USB PD SOP' and SOP'' CommunicationSam Hurst2019-01-071-2/+56
* tcpc: remove reset check in alert handlerJett Rink2018-12-181-4/+12
* tcpc: wait for TCPC wake up upon first accessJett Rink2018-12-181-52/+49
* tcpc: Resume suspended ports after an intervalJonathan Brandmeyer2018-10-041-3/+11
* pdchipinfo: add min firmware version to pdchipinfoJett Rink2018-09-281-35/+13
* pd: Change tcpm_set_drp_toggle() to tcpm_enable_drp_toggle()Edward Hill2018-09-171-4/+1
* pd: Add PD_FLAGS_LPM_TRANSITIONEdward Hill2018-09-171-4/+1
* tcpm: add TCPC RX circular buffer in ECJett Rink2018-09-071-24/+140
* ss-mux: update semantics for TCPC/MUX only used as MUXJett Rink2018-09-051-53/+20
* i2c: Split i2c_xfer into locked/unlocked versions.Jonathan Brandmeyer2018-08-161-2/+14
* ps8751: add low power mode for PS8751 when only MUXJett Rink2018-08-151-19/+75
* drivers: Refactor to use high-level i2c APIsJonathan Brandmeyer2018-08-091-11/+30
* usbc_mux: Adding low power mode to USB MUXJett Rink2018-08-091-7/+2
* tcpm: wait for TCPC to init upon first tcpc accessJett Rink2018-07-251-0/+71
* tcpc: debounce entry into low-power modeJett Rink2018-07-181-15/+34
* tcpci: Adjust pd task event/wake when processing alertsScott Collyer2018-05-141-6/+16
* tcpci: reset TCPC if alert mask is resetJett Rink2018-04-271-20/+33
* mux: add mode for TCPCI mux that is not the TCPCJett Rink2018-04-241-8/+19
* tcpci: Change role control setting for auto-toggle enableScott Collyer2018-04-111-1/+1
* tcpci: add vbus caching back for tcpci except in parade driverJett Rink2018-04-101-17/+12
* ppc: Add tcpci snk/src control via the COMMAND registerScott Collyer2018-04-101-0/+22
* tcpc: verify that i2c_read for vbus succeedsJett Rink2018-04-101-3/+5
* tcpci: remove vbus level cachingJett Rink2018-04-031-12/+15
* tcpc: rename CONFIG_USB_PD_TCPM_ANX74XX to CONFIG_USB_PD_TCPM_ANX3429Jett Rink2018-03-231-1/+3
* ps8xxx: use custom tcpm_drvCaveh Jalali2017-08-161-2/+2
* driver: tcpm: ps8xxx: Add support for PS8805.Aseda Aboagye2017-07-111-4/+5
* tcpm: add .release driver operation.Caveh Jalali2017-06-281-0/+33